Filters:
clear
debit order collection services
clear
Durban
clear
Country: South Africa

debit order collection services in Durban

About 1 results.

Three Peaks

22A Underwood Rd, Hatton Estate Pinetown, 3610 South Africa, 3610 Durban, South Africa

Three Peaks is a South African authorized Financial Services Provider with a Debit Order System that gives businesses simple, secure ways of automatically collecting payments from customers.

  • 1